Output 68935e8ecb33e3c7af9c2decf7152654e69ad940db6f8a5835ef462bba4a52d0:1

value
2558720
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c3a918ded2f93e37021c02978ad3ea61e0c85b31959929e8e0773efc90a2e82
address
bc1pmsafrr0d97f7xuppcq5h3tf75c0qepdnr9ve985wqae7ljg296pq284vya
transaction
68935e8ecb33e3c7af9c2decf7152654e69ad940db6f8a5835ef462bba4a52d0
spent
true